While treadmills may appear simple, various types accommodate different requirements and choices. Here are the main classifications:

Manual Treadmills: These require no power and are propelled by the user's effort. They typically use up less area and are quieter however can provide a steeper knowing curve for novices.

Electric or Motorized Treadmills: The most common type, they include automated programs for speed and incline. They are typically more flexible however require electrical power to run.

Folding Treadmills: Designed for those with restricted space, folding treadmills can be collapsed and kept away when not in usage, making them perfect for studio apartments.

Incline Treadmills: These machines use the capability to raise the slope, imitating hill runs for a more efficient exercise.

Industrial Treadmills: Built for heavy usage, these machines are usually found in health clubs and gym and come with a variety of features and durability.

A1: It is typically advised to use a treadmill a minimum of three times per week for 30-60 minutes to see substantial results.
Q2: Can I slim down using a treadmill?
A2: Yes, with a mix of routine exercise, a balanced diet plan, and part control, utilizing a treadmill can contribute considerably to weight loss.
Q3: Do I need to warm-up before using the treadmill?
A3: Yes, heating up is important to prepare your body, decrease the danger of injury, and improve workout efficiency.
Q4: Is operating on a treadmill as reliable as running outdoors?
A4: Both have benefits, however a treadmill enables regulated environments, avoiding weather-related disturbances, and might have less impact on the joints.
Q5: Can a treadmill assistance with bodybuilding?
A5: While primarily a cardiovascular tool, changing slopes can help engage and enhance particular leg muscles.
